    | Partname: | ADCS7477 |  
    | Description: | 1MSPS, 12-/10-/8-Bit A/D Converters in 6-Lead SOT-23 |     
    | Manufacturer: | National Semiconductor |

    The ADCS7476/77/78 uses the supply voltage as a reference. This enables the devices to operate with a full-scale input range of 0 to VDD. The conversion rate is determined from the serial clock (SCLK) speed. These converters offer a shutdown mode, which can be used to trade throughput for power consumption. The ADCS7476/77/78 is operated with a single supply that can range from +2.7V to +5.25V. Normal power consumption during continuous conversion, using a +3V or +5V supply, is 2 mW or 10 mW respectively. The power down feature, which is enabled by a chip select (CS) pin, reduces the power consumption to under 5 W using a +5V supply. All three converters are packaged in a 6-lead, SOT-23 package that provides an extremely small footprint for applications where space is a critical consideration. These products are designed for operation over the automotive/extended industrial temperature range of -40C to +125C.  |
